The active catalog currently contains 631 products and 640 variants, so buyers need a disciplined subset rather than a full-range export.
Tony Moly makeup depth depends on accurate shade merchandising across lip, eye, cheek and base products.
A focused first order reduces dead stock risk while preserving the commercial strength of Tony Moly makeup.
Sun-care products need market-specific review for SPF, PA, approved filters, functional wording and import requirements.
Hand creams, body care, masks, skincare and sunscreen records include scent-led or concern-led positioning that can require local wording control.
The makeup range is commercially strong but can create slow-moving shade tails if the first order carries too many colors without channel data.
UV Master items should not be treated like standard skincare because sunscreen claims, approved filters and label rules vary by market.
The active Tony Moly range is deep enough to support many channels, but first orders should separate replenishment groups from novelty, tools and seasonal products.
